How much do internship grammarly j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 31, 2026, the average hourly pay for internship grammarly in the United States is $15.54,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$12.50 and $17.55 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Internship Grammarly typically involves assisting with editing, proofreading, and improving writing using Grammarly tools, focusing on language accuracy. Content Writer Internships focus on creating original content, developing writing skills, and producing articles or marketing materials. Both roles are entry-level, often remote, and valuable for aspiring writers or editors. The main difference lies in the focus: editing and language correction versus content creation.
